Corfe Castle, Wareham, Dorset

Thousand-year-old castle rising above the Isle of Purbeck.

The majestic ruins had been an important stronghold since the time of William the Conqueror. In 1646, following a lengthy siege, Parliamentarian forces destroyed the building, leaving the ruins we see today. Many fine Norman and early English features remain.
